随着区块链技术的快速发展,Tokenim 2.0作为一款新兴的区块链项目,备受开发者与投资者的关注。其源码中包含了丰富的功能与应用场景,能够为开发者提供很好的参考。本文将详细解析Tokenim 2.0的源码结构、功能以及应用场景,并解答与其相关的一些疑问,帮助您更好地理解和使用这个项目。

Tokenim 2.0源码结构解析

Tokenim 2.0的源码结构相对清晰,主要分为几个模块:核心模块、智能合约模块、用户界面模块、数据库模块等。每个模块承担着特定的功能,下面我们逐一介绍。

核心模块

核心模块是Tokenim 2.0的核心部分,主要负责处理区块链的基本操作,如交易的产生与确认、区块的生成与验证等。此模块对性能要求较高,通常采用多线程或异步编程技术来提高处理速度。

智能合约模块

智能合约模块是Tokenim 2.0的重要组成部分,它允许开发者在区块链上编写和部署自己的合约。该模块支持以太坊的Solidity语言,同时也实现了自己的合约语言,以便于不同需求的开发者使用。

用户界面模块

用户界面模块为用户提供了友好的操作界面,包括钱包管理、交易记录、合约交互等功能。该模块的设计注重用户体验,通过简洁明了的布局和操作,降低用户的学习成本。

数据库模块

数据库模块则负责存储区块链上的数据,包括用户信息、交易记录、合约状态等。这部分的设计需要兼顾数据的安全性与访问速度,通常会采用去中心化存储方案以提高安全性。

Tokenim 2.0的应用场景

Tokenim 2.0的应用场景非常广泛,适用于多种行业。比如,金融行业可以利用其智能合约技术实现去中心化交易平台;而在供应链管理中,Tokenim 2.0的区块链技术可以确保数据的透明性与不可篡改性。

Tokenim 2.0与其他区块链项目的区别

与其他区块链项目相比,Tokenim 2.0在以下几个方面表现突出:首先,它在可扩展性上有着明显优势,支持多种链间互操作;其次,Tokenim 2.0在智能合约的处理速度上也处于领先地位,为高频交易提供了保障。

相关问题解答

1. Tokenim 2.0的安全性如何保证?

Tokenim 2.0在安全性方面采取了多种措施,确保用户资产和数据的安全。首先,在核心模块中,采用了多重签名技术来签署交易,降低了单点故障的风险;其次,智能合约模块经过严格的审核与测试,及时修复漏洞;此外,数据库模块定期备份与加密,防止数据丢失或被篡改。

2. 如何使用Tokenim 2.0进行智能合约开发?

为了使用Tokenim 2.0进行智能合约开发,开发者需要首先下载并安装相关的开发环境。接着,在智能合约模块中,按照提供的文档与示例代码进行合约的编写。完成后,可通过区块链浏览器进行合约的部署与测试,确保合约功能的正常运行。

3. Tokenim 2.0的未来发展方向是什么?

Tokenim 2.0的未来发展方向主要集中在以下几个方面:一是加强与其他区块链项目的互操作性,推进跨链技术的发展;二是探索更多行业应用,如NFT市场、去中心化金融(DeFi)等;三是系统性能,进一步提升交易速度与确认时间,以更好地满足市场需求。

4. 如何参与Tokenim 2.0的社区建设?

参与Tokenim 2.0社区建设的方式有很多,用户可以通过加入官方论坛、社群以及社交媒体平台,参与到话题讨论与建议中来;此外,开发者还可以贡献代码、帮助修复bug,积极参与项目的迭代升级。

总结来说,Tokenim 2.0的源码不仅展示了其在区块链领域的技术实力,更是在智能合约开发及应用方面提供了广阔的机会。通过深入了解其源码与应用场景,开发者与用户能够更好地把握未来的区块链趋势。